Mail Call season 6 episode 8, titled "Iwo Jima Special," takes viewers on an immersive journey into the historic battle that took place on the island of Iwo Jima during World War II. Hosted by the charismatic R. Lee Ermey, a former drill instructor in the United States Marine Corps, this installment of Mail Call provides a unique opportunity to delve into the details of one of the most significant battles in American military history.

The episode begins by setting the stage and giving viewers a broader understanding of the strategic importance of Iwo Jima. R. Lee Ermey provides insightful context, highlighting the island's location and the valuable airfields that Japan had built there. As we learn, these airfields allowed enemy forces to launch devastating attacks on American bombers, putting both pilots and strategic objectives at risk.

Throughout the episode, R. Lee Ermey shares fascinating stories and facts about the battle, providing a comprehensive overview of the events that unfolded during the grueling 36-day conflict. He details the initial amphibious assault that saw American troops landing on the shores of Iwo Jima, facing a formidable array of Japanese defenses. Through archival footage and expert interviews, viewers get a firsthand glimpse into the harsh realities faced by both sides during the intense fighting.

One of the highlights of this episode is the opportunity to hear personal accounts from veterans who participated in the battle. R. Lee Ermey introduces us to several courageous individuals who share their vivid memories and experiences in Iwo Jima. These firsthand testimonies put a human face on the historical events, illustrating the bravery and sacrifices made by these men in the face of unimaginable adversity.

In addition to the personal narratives, the episode also showcases a wide array of military technology used during the battle. R. Lee Ermey provides detailed explanations of key weapons and equipment employed by the U.S. Marines as they sought to overcome the entrenched Japanese forces. From flamethrowers to tanks and artillery, viewers gain an appreciation for the innovation and firepower that helped shape the outcome of this pivotal conflict.

Moreover, "Iwo Jima Special" explores the logistical challenges faced by the American forces throughout the battle. R. Lee Ermey discusses the intricacies of moving supplies, troops, and equipment across the difficult terrain of the island. Viewers discover the immense effort required to establish and maintain a foothold on Iwo Jima, and the resourcefulness displayed by the Marines in the face of constant enemy resistance.

As the episode draws to a close, R. Lee Ermey reflects on the significance and legacy of the Battle of Iwo Jima. He pays tribute to the immense courage and sacrifice of the U.S. Marines, who emerged victorious but at a high cost. With a deep sense of respect, he reminds viewers of the lasting impact this battle had on American military history and the lessons that can be gleaned from it.
